Illinois Jones is being pulled from a snake pit with a rope that breaks if the tension in it exceeds 755 N.

(a) If Illinois Jones has a mass of 70.0 kg and the snake pit is 3.40 m deep, what is the minimum time that is required to pull our intrepid explorer from the pit?

(b) Explain why the rope breaks if Jones is pulled from the pit in less time than that calculated in part (a).
